Spicy Beef Nachos

I wanted a quick way to satisfy my craving for that typical Mexican nacho flavour and I think I found it!!!

Ingredients

30 mins
4 servings
  1. meat sauce
  2. 2 tbspolive oil
  3. 1onion
  4. 2 clovegarlic
  5. 400 gramsground beef
  6. 1 tspchilli powder (1/2 or 1/4 for less fire)
  7. 2 tspground cumin
  8. 2 tspsmoked paprika
  9. 1 canred kidney beans (drained)
  10. 1 cuppassato (or 1/2 cup tomato paste etc)
  11. 1/2 cupwater
  12. guacamole
  13. 2avocado
  14. 1fine dice tomato (scoop out seeds)
  15. 2 tbsplemon juice
  16. General
  17. 1 packagescorn chips
  18. 1 cupsour cream
  19. 2 cupgrated cheese

Cooking Instructions

30 mins
  1. 1

    Heat oil in pan.

  2. 2

    Medium dice onion and add to pan. Add garlic. Cook a few minutes on medium.

  3. 3

    Add beef mince and all spices. Break mince up with wooden spoon.

  4. 4

    Add passato, red kidney beans and 1/2 cup water. Simmer medium heat until sauce reduces .

  5. 5

    Put sauce in oven dish, cover with corn chips, and cover with grated cheese. Bake medium until cheese melts.

  6. 6

    Make the guacamole while the cheese melts. Spoon out avocados and mash in bowl with fork. Add diced tomato and lemon juice. Salt and pepper to taste.

  7. 7

    Blob guacamole and sour cream over the top and serve!
